Price Range & Condition
In very good condition, we estimate 10, Woodbrooke Road, Birmingham would be worth £434,650, with a potential rental value of £730 per month.
If substantial cosmetic improvements are needed, the estimated sale value falls to £384,976, with a rental value of £647 per month.
The extent to which decoration affects a property's value depends on its type, size and location.
Energy Efficiency
10, Woodbrooke Road, Birmingham has an Energy Performance Rating (EPC) of D. This is based on the most recent assessment, dated 23 Apr 2019.
The property is connected to mains gas and has single glazed windows. It is heated using Boiler and radiators, mains gas.
